§ 7-32-122 — Filing objections to assessments

All persons whose property it is proposed to assess for the cost of the improvement or any costs incurred pursuant to § 7-32-101(d) may, at any time on or before the date named in the notice, and before the meeting of the legislative body, file in writing with the city clerk or person designated any objections or defense to the proposed assessment or to the amount of the assessment.

Legislative History

Acts 1913 (1st Ex. Sess.), ch. 18, § 6; Shan., § 1991a21; mod. Code 1932, § 3428; T.C.A. (orig. ed.), § 6-1122; Acts 2007, ch. 493, § 3.
